Friday, 15 November, 2002, 11:38 GMT
Old Bailey trial for Soham suspects
Maxine Carr and Ian Huntley will be tried in London
The trial of the two people charged in connection with the disappearance and deaths of schoolgirls Holly Wells and Jessica Chapman will take place at the Old Bailey in London, a judge has ruled.
Mr Justice Moses, sitting at Norwich Crown Court, said the trial of Maxine Carr and her boyfriend Ian Huntley should be moved out of East Anglia because of concerns that jurors might have links to strands of the police investigation. No date has yet been set for the trial.
Ms Carr, 25, a former teaching assistant at the girls' school in Soham, is charged with attempting to pervert the course of justice. Holly Wells and Jessica Chapman, both 10, disappeared from their home town of Soham on 4 August. Their bodies were found in a ditch at Lakenheath, Suffolk, on 17 August. Mr Huntley is being held at Woodhill Prison, near Milton Keynes, pending the trial. Ms Carr is being held at Holloway prison, north London, pending the trial. Neither have yet entered pleas to the allegations.
